The Cambridge News (formerly the Cambridge Evening News) is a British daily newspaper.Published each weekday and on Saturdays, it is distributed from its Milton base. In the period December 2010 – June 2011 it had an average daily circulation of 20,987, [2] but by December 2016 this had fallen to around 13,000. [3]

The CBS Evening News is a daily evening broadcast featuring news reports, feature stories and interviews by CBS News correspondents and reporters covering events around the world. The program has been broadcast since July 1, 1941, under the original title CBS Television News , eventually adopting its existing title in 1963.

Peter Samuel Cook (17 August 1928 – 9 January 2004) [1] [2] was a British serial rapist who attacked women in Cambridge, England and so became known in the press as the Cambridge Rapist. [3] He attacked women after breaking into their bedsits and flats. [ 4 ]
